Born Maria Anna Angelika Kauffmann on October 30, 1741, in Chur, Switzerland, Angelica Kauffman’s life was a testament to ambition and artistic determination. Her early years were marked by a nomadic existence, shaped by her father, Joseph Johann Kauffmann, a skilled muralist who traveled extensively throughout Europe. This itinerant upbringing exposed young Angelica to diverse artistic styles and cultures, laying the foundation for her own distinctive approach. Unlike many women of her time, she received formal training in painting, initially under her father and later with renowned artists like Louis-Joseph Dorval in Florence – a pivotal experience that solidified her commitment to a career in art.
Florence proved to be a crucial period in Kauffman’s development. There, amidst the vibrant artistic scene of the late 18th century, she embraced Neoclassicism, a style characterized by its emphasis on classical themes, idealized forms, and precise draughtsmanship. This influence is evident in her early portraits and historical paintings, which often depicted noblewomen and mythological figures with an elegant restraint and meticulous attention to detail. Her ability to capture the subtle nuances of expression and the beauty of human form quickly garnered recognition.
Kauffman’s artistic output spanned a diverse range of subjects, including portraits, historical scenes, landscapes, and mythological compositions. However, she is particularly renowned for her history paintings – large-scale works that depicted significant events from the past. These paintings were not merely decorative; they served as vehicles for exploring themes of heroism, virtue, and national identity. Her style was characterized by a balanced combination of technical skill and emotional depth. She skillfully employed light and shadow to create dramatic effects, while also capturing the psychological complexities of her subjects.
Notably, Kauffman’s work often reflected her Swiss heritage and her experiences in Italy. The influence of Italian Renaissance art is palpable in her compositions, color palettes, and use of classical motifs. She was a keen observer of nature, and her landscapes are imbued with a sense of tranquility and beauty.

Angelica Kauffman’s career was remarkable not only for its artistic achievements but also for its historical context. As a woman artist in an era dominated by male figures, she faced significant obstacles and prejudices. Yet, she persevered, establishing herself as one of the most successful and respected artists of her time. Her success paved the way for future generations of women to pursue careers in art.
Kauffman’s legacy extends beyond her individual works. She challenged conventional notions of femininity and artistic identity, demonstrating that women were capable of producing sophisticated and meaningful art. Her story serves as an inspiration to artists and scholars alike, reminding us of the importance of recognizing and celebrating the contributions of women in the history of art.
Angelica Kauffman died on November 5, 1807, at the age of 66, leaving behind a rich artistic legacy that continues to be admired and studied today. Her paintings offer a glimpse into the world of 18th-century Europe, revealing the beauty, elegance, and intellectual curiosity of a remarkable artist.
